Ideal Home Locations

When looking for a home to purchase, the seemingly endless details to consider can seem overwhelming, but it's also important to remember to take a step back and consider the big picture the area surrounding a potential home. There are many reasons why you need a home located in a good area. The area location can also affect the loan amount. Private mortgage insurance is easier to get if the home is in a good area. If the home is in a good location, then you can get more loans and the resale value of your home would be greater. Here are a few things that you should consider.

Look Around You

What is the traffic flow situation? If commuting is a concern, make sure to visit the home during different times of the day to test accessibility. Are there unsightly concerns near the property? You should use different routes to the home to make sure that there are no dumpsites or abandoned lots. Is the area noisy? Stroll around the house to see if there are any dog kennels, highway noise, airplane flight routes, and the like. Is the lighting good? A location that has good lighting would have lesser crime and traffic accidents. What is the condition of roads, sidewalks, and drains? These can have an effect on homeowner's insurance.

Ask The Neighbours

Don't be afraid to contact neighbours about the area. They can be a great source of information about the neighbourhood, and checking with several residents can provide a well-rounded view of the location. Ask them about the schools, nearby shopping, noise level, crime, etc. Ask if they would buy in the neighbourhood again.

Check Around

If you need to verify a few things before you buy a house, then a real estate agent can help you. You can check public records to find out what current or pending assessments for the area are. The police department can provide an analysis of crime in the area both the type and volume. Real estate agents or appraisers can give you an overview of the property values in a particular area. Be sure to check the quality of the actual house as well, including heating and cooling units, appliances, and foundation.

In most mortgage appraisal guidelines, homes in ideal locations are better. So the most important criterion for buying a home is always the location.

Showing Day Things You Should Do

The truth is, the best thing for you to do on showing day is to not be home. Believe it or not. To show your home, the best qualified person would be your Realtor. While you may think you know the home best, it is the RealtorĀ®'s job to know the client best, and to know what they are looking for in a home. So during the days that your home is being shown, do whatever it takes to get you out of the house, kick back and relax at a friend's house or go for a drive and a shopping trip.

It's really before the showing day that your work comes in. One of these is to share all you know about your home with your Realtor. The better they will be able to sell it if they know more about the home. Hiding your home's flaws from the Realtor is a big mistake. Sooner or later these will come up anyway. It's best if your RealtorĀ® knows everything, the good and the bad. This way, they will be able to promote the good and understate the bad. Aside from being able to provide creative solutions to what you perceive as problems with the home, they may also know about a niche market of buyers that actually wants those features in a home.

The other major job for you is to clean up. Your home should be clean and this is very important. Cleaning better than you normally would is a must. I'm not implying you are a sloppy cleaner, it's just that a home being shown for sale needs to be completely clean, top to bottom, with no corner or crevice forgotten. You should not forget about cupboards or closets either since buyers almost always open these up to have a look. The drapes and carpets should also be professionally cleaned.

Along with cleaning comes de-cluttering. It is imperative that you remove clutter from your home. This will take more than tidying up because you might have to get rid of some of your decorations. Choose only one figurine if you are the type who have lots of little figurines or a vase collection then put the rest of them in storage. There are times when spare rooms and storage spaces are the key selling features which means you shouldn't cram everything in there. Renting a storage space is one thing you can consider. Since you will be moving anyway, having some of your things packed up before the house even sells could make things a lot easier when it's actually time to move.

With any luck, these tips will help you have a successful showing and help your home sell fast.

Don’t Be Fooled By Home Staging

Based on a report that was just out, being fooled by home staging is actually very easy. A term that we are gradually becoming familiar with is home staging. It is the idea that we try to create the best impression of our home when selling the house. There is a whole set of rules to follow nowadays unlike before when it used to be just the run the vacuum over it and do the dishes.

A staged home will stand out from all the others and because of this fact, it will get sold more quickly. This can be carried to extremes with reports of sellers hiring storage units in order to cart their junk off to. In order for the house to look bigger and more spacious, larger items of furniture are encouraged to be put into storage by professional 'home stagers.'

If you want the prospective buyer to visualize the house as their own, then another instruction is to remove anything personal like photographs. All the bathroom paraphernalia should be removed from the counter top and closets must be de-cluttered so that they look more spacious. You should also remove garbage bins and hide them from sight.

Home staging can also be deliberately used and this has been suggested in order to hide a multitude of sins.

As much as 82% of buyers are sidetracked from the important issues by a well-staged house and this was suggested by the National Association of Exclusive Buyer Agents or NAEBA who solely represents buyers in the realty business. This organization also concedes that home staging nets more cash and faster sales - so it works!

Using smaller furniture to make a room look larger, using curtains to hide rotting sills, as well as placing rugs over damaged parts are some examples of the underhand tricks that are used in staging. Another thing that's specified is the practice of putting a cheap paint job so that the defects will be covered. Your Realtor is legally obligated to let you know of any defects, but only if he actually knows about them!

Urged by the NAEBA to be cautious are the buyers and they should remember that when the house is sold, the stage is taken away. The tricks of home staging do not improve the floor plan, or the square footage of the home or the quality of the neighborhood, and these are the qualities that you will be re-selling at a later date.

Aspects To Consider When Looking For Remortgage Deals

In order to buy property a substantial sum of money is needed, and as a result most people resort to a mortgage so as to be able to make the purchase. Mortgage deals change in time, and what seemed to be a beneficial arrangement a decade ago, may not prove to be that advantageous presently. That is why remortgage deals are sometimes checked out by some borrowers who attempt to find a better and more profitable option.

Remortgaging refers to the process where a loan one has had gets cancelled, and then a new mortgage is issued by another lender who is providing a better deal. Usually the new lender will be providing more appealing terms, which will often enable the borrower to save money in the process.

Other common reasons include more flexibility, and a different rate and type of interest. Obviously one needs to make sure to consider all the relevant factors carefully prior to making such a decision. There will be fees and charges associated with remortgaging, so you will need to calculate whether it is profitable or not to go through with the new agreement.

All the terms and conditions should be read and understood so as to make sure that a good choice is being made. It is also important to take the time to check the new lender's reputation.

When looking for remortgage deals you need to place importance on the type of interest that will be charged. If for example your present mortgage has a variable interest, and there is an indication that there may be an increase in the rate, then it may be profitable to remortgage with a fixed rate deal.

Some borrowers also place importance on the level of flexibility that is provided. Some agreements restrict a borrower from making overpayments by posing a fee. Hence, a remortgage which allows you to make overpayments without any fees, and which provides you with lower monthly repayments will definitely be worthwhile.

With such an agreement you may also be able to release equity, which can then be used to invest in your property in the form of renovations, repairs and reconstructions. This can in most cases add value to your property, so you would be investing and utilizing funds wisely.

If in the past you were issued a loan and you were unemployed or had a bad credit history, then it is generally best if you consider a remortgage deal. In time you may have a steady job and your credit rating may have improved, so as a result you will most probably be able to get a better interest rate if you remortgage.

Selling More Real Estate Rentals

Selling real estate rentals is quite different from selling houses. You could have a house painted to improve its appearance. Rental properties, especially larger ones, are different, because they're bought by investors, who look at income more than new paint. Raise the income, and you increase value to investors.

Find out what capitalization rates are. If investors are expecting a capitalization rate of 0.08 in your area, then they want a net return (before the loan payments and taxes) of 8% on the purchase price. So if your three-plex generates $12,000 net income annually, they'll value it around $150,000 ($12,000 divided by .08). If you can have it generating $16,000, then it would be worth $200,000.

More Income From Real Estate Rentals

Of course raising the rent is the most obvious way to increase income, that is, if you can justify it. Find out what the rates are of similar units. If your units are $60 below the going rate, then you can raise it and not lose your renters. By increasing the rates of 3 apartments by $60, you will gain $2160 more every year. Your property will be worth $27,000 more with a 0.08 cap rate.

You can increase the rate in other ways, too. Add a carport, and your tenants might be willing to pay $30 additional every month. That's $1080 more net income annually, meaning roughly $13,500 more value added to your property. (That's $30 x 3 units x 12 months equals to $1,080 divided by 0.08 cap rate, which gives you $13,500.) If the carport costs $4,000 to build, then pretty good return on investment, eh? What else do they want?

You should think of other ways to gain more income than by just increasing the rent. Storage sheds can be rented to tenants or you could put in a coin-operated washer and dryer. You can also install pop machines.

Decreasing Expenses

Could you add insulation to reduce the heating costs? If you're paying $80/month for lawn care, will one of the tenants do it for $40? Can you get cheaper insurance? Decreasing the expenses will increase your net income, but don't go overboard or you'll scare your tenants away. A new $4,000 furnace that saves $800/year on heating costs means you just turned $4,000 into a $10,000 higher sales price.

And obviously, the appearance and other factors matter, too. But know that increasing the net income is the best way to get more for your rental real estate. If you can, make the changes a year or a few months before selling the property. Also, learn how do the math - it really does matter with real estate rentals.
